According to the management of the FH, the termination of the two professors has nothing to do with the plagiarism allegations that are now being discussed. Because the layoffs had already been pronounced in June, while the FH only found out about the plagiarism allegations on Wednesday.

The professor, who went public because of his resignation, plagiarized many “school materials without naming the source” in his thesis, said “plagiarism hunter” Stefan Weber to the Austria Press Agency on Wednesday. The published the topic in the morning.
The academic had turned to regional media in the course of his dispute before the labor court at the end of last week. After 13 years at the FH, he was suddenly fired without warning. Because the man is fighting the dismissal in front of the labor court, the FH management has not issued a statement citing this ongoing procedure.
Weber, who is known for uncovering numerous plagiarized scientific works by celebrities, now checked the diploma theses of the two professors. In the 52-page work professors who had turned to the media, he found “plagiarism of text from paragraph to page”.

The sources are just as “shocking” as the copious plagiarism: In two cases, literature from the school context was verifiably plagiarized, ”said Weber.
And further: “A graduate student plagiarized school literature as well as a Berlin term paper in his thesis and submits this elaborate to the same university of applied sciences at which he later becomes a professor and then supervises bachelor theses himself. Now the question is obvious: Which citation and quality standards were actually in effect during the period of care of the ‘renowned’ specialist colleague? “

The professor concerned was initially unavailable for the APA on Wednesday morning. And the FH announced in a statement from an internal audit: “We have high scientific standards at our university of applied sciences. All work must comply with the examination regulations. With their signature, students affirm that they follow the quality standards. “
The reviewers are also bound by it: “It is therefore also important to us to examine the situation in detail. The plagiarism software ‘Turnitin’ is used at the Salzburg University of Applied Sciences, which is also very popular at other universities, ”said the University of Applied Sciences in its statement to the APA.
At the time of the thesis in 2001, however, there was no such software. The FH did not comment on the second diploma thesis because it had been submitted to another university.
